fold-const: Handle bitfields in native_encode_initializer [PR93121]
When working on __builtin_bit_cast that needs to handle bitfields too, I've made the following change to handle at least some bitfields in native_encode_initializer (those that have integral representative). 2020-07-20 Jakub Jelinek <jakub@redhat.com> PR libstdc++/93121 * fold-const.c (native_encode_initializer): Handle bit-fields. * gcc.dg/tree-ssa/pr93121-1.c: New test.
